The short answer is this: the PPWR empty space ratio does not place a 50 percent cap on every retail sales pack. Instead, the rule applies to grouped packaging, transport packaging, and e-commerce packaging that fall within its scope. Retail sales packaging certainly still matters under the PPWR, but the main question is quite different. For retail packs, teams must demonstrate that the package's weight and volume are strictly necessary for it to perform its intended job.
This distinction matters in practice because many packaging teams mix up shelf packs and outer packs. By separating these two issues early on, you can evaluate compliance risks more clearly and improve volumetric design without sacrificing product protection or on-shelf presence.

What the PPWR empty space ratio actually covers
Many teams hear about the 50 percent cap and naturally assume it applies to every package they sell. However, this is a common misunderstanding. Under the regulation, the PPWR empty space ratio is targeted specifically at grouped packaging, transport packaging, and in-scope e-commerce packaging. Consequently, it factors into discussions concerning empty space ratios and packaging void space rules for outer formats, rather than serving as a blanket rule for every single shelf pack.
Timing is also a critical factor. The empty space requirement belongs to a future framework linked to the 2030 period, so teams should always verify the latest wording in the legal text. For factual confirmation, the safest source remains the official text published on EUR-Lex, as the precise wording, scope, and timing will directly affect how a packaging review should be handled.
Why many teams confuse the rule with retail sales packaging
This confusion is easy to understand, primarily because a single product often moves through multiple packaging levels. It might require a sales pack for the retail shelf, a grouped outer box for multiple units, a robust transport format for distribution, and a dedicated shipper for online delivery. People often see the word "packaging" and assume every level is regulated in exactly the same way. In reality, each format serves a different purpose, meaning the legal questions surrounding them differ as well.
How the PPWR empty space ratio relates to retail sales packs
Retail sales packs are certainly still affected by the PPWR, though primarily through minimization rules. In simple terms, the weight and volume of the sales pack must be strictly necessary for its intended function. That function might include product protection, visibility, providing consumer information, specialized opening features, theft prevention, or another clear requirement. This is why the PPWR empty space ratio remains relevant to retail packaging teams, even when the 50 percent cap does not directly govern the individual shelf unit.
For a standard blister card sitting on the shelf, the compliance review typically focuses on whether the package size and material usage are justified. It is not automatically concerned with whether that specific unit stays below a fixed 50 percent void threshold. This distinction is crucial because it completely changes how teams approach oversized packaging regulations and how they define right-sized retail packaging.
The key difference between a sales pack and grouped, transport, or e-commerce packaging
A sales pack is the primary unit a shopper sees and purchases in a store. Grouped packaging bundles several of these sales units together. Transport packaging facilitates safe handling and movement throughout the broader supply chain. Finally, e-commerce packaging is the shipping format used to deliver goods to the end consumer. Because these formats perform distinctly different jobs, the regulatory review criteria for each are correspondingly different.
| Sales packaging | Grouped, transport, and e-commerce packaging |
| Scope: Shelf unit bought by the consumer | Scope: Outer formats used to group, ship, or deliver sales units |
| Key question: Is the weight and volume necessary for its function? | Key question: Does the empty space rule apply, and how is the void measured under the official method? |
| Design implication: Review the card area, cup shape, visibility, and structure | Design implication: Review the fit of packed units, the shipping cavity, and unused outer volume |
How to think about the PPWR empty space ratio without overclaiming the calculation
For grouped, transport, and e-commerce formats, the PPWR empty space ratio deals specifically with the space that is not occupied by the packaged sales units, as defined by the official PPWR measurement method. While that sounds straightforward, packaging teams must remain careful because the prescribed methodology matters greatly. A homemade formula might be useful for an early design review, but it will not hold up as a legal answer. This distinction is especially vital when teams attempt to assess void ratios for grouped packaging, transport packaging empty space, or e-commerce packaging empty space.
It is also important to avoid another common assumption regarding void fill. Fillers such as air cushions, crumpled paper, or bubble wrap can certainly protect products during shipping, but they should never be treated as an automatic fix under packaging void space rules. Product protection and legal volumetric measurement are related topics, but they are absolutely not the same thing.
What empty space means in practice
In practice, empty space usually refers to the unused cavity surrounding multiple sales units inside a master shipper. It can also refer to the gap left inside an e-commerce box after the purchased products are packed. That is exactly why grouped packaging, transport packaging, and e-commerce formats are typically the first places teams look when reviewing their PPWR empty space exposure and overall outer pack efficiency.

What the PPWR empty space ratio means for pack design choices
This is where the topic becomes incredibly useful for retail packaging teams. Some packages manufacture visual size using a large backing card, a deep blister cup, or an excessively wide outer construction. Even if the 50 percent cap does not technically apply to that specific sales unit, retail pack minimization still dictates that the package's weight and volume must be strictly necessary for its function. Consequently, package design should always begin with product fit and functional purpose, subsequently building strong shelf impact through smarter structural engineering and compelling graphics.
Adopting this approach helps teams review their volumetric packaging design in a highly practical way. It also supports robust shelf presence, proving that visual impact can stem from clear branding, enhanced product visibility, unique shapes, and smart format logic, rather than simply relying on unused air.
Example
While a large card and deep cup might create an illusion of visual size, a contour-fit cup paired with stronger graphics can deliver a similar shelf impact while drastically reducing unused volume.

Using the PPWR empty space ratio as a check for grouped and e-commerce packaging
Following the sales pack review, the outer packaging must undergo its own independent evaluation. This is where the PPWR empty space ratio becomes a direct and pressing question. Grouped packaging, transport packaging, and e-commerce shipping formats should always be checked separately, as their internal cavities, physical fit, and specific shipping needs are often vastly different from those of the retail sales units they contain.
Separate the sales pack review from the outer pack review
Splitting these evaluations keeps the entire project clear and focused. The first review asks whether the shelf pack truly needs its current size and material footprint to function properly. The second review asks whether the outer packaging contains unnecessary void space under the applicable regulatory rules. When teams mistakenly combine these two completely different questions, they frequently miss simple design improvements or create deep confusion regarding which packaging level is actually in scope.
Where packaging engineers should look first
Engineers should always start by analyzing the base product dimensions, the cup shape, the card size, and the overall package thickness. From there, they can review how individual units are grouped, how snugly they fit into a master shipper, and how they are physically arranged for transport or online delivery. In many projects, issues with void ratios in grouped packaging unexpectedly appear simply because the retail pack and the outer pack were designed in isolation, meaning the final system was never holistically optimized as one complete supply chain.

Two design checks before you change a format
If you are currently reviewing a package because of empty space ratio concerns or broader PPWR questions, we strongly recommend splitting the project into two distinct checks. This methodology keeps the actual work highly practical and makes it much easier to align the engineering, brand, and compliance teams around the right questions.
Check one, sales packaging minimization
First, ask whether the weight and volume are strictly necessary for adequate protection, consumer information, product display, smooth opening features, reliable recloseability, theft prevention, or another legitimate function. Carefully review the card area, the blister cup depth, and the overall package shape. For retail sales units sitting in physical stores, this is quite often the main issue to resolve.
Check two, grouped, transport, and e-commerce packaging
Second, ask whether the outer format actually falls under the empty space requirement and determine precisely how the official measurement method applies. Thoroughly review the shipper fit, the grouping logic, the internal shipping cavity, and the final outer dimensions. Before ever making a concrete compliance claim, verify the testing methodology with your dedicated compliance team, as any legal interpretation should be based firmly on the approved route utilized by your business.
Checklist
• What is the actual product size, and what space does it truly require?
• What must the sales pack accomplish both on the shelf and during handling?
• Is the total card area genuinely necessary for function and communication?
• Does the blister cup shape follow the product's contours closely enough?
• Is there a separate grouped or e-commerce outer pack that requires its own dedicated review?
Questions teams often ask
Does the 50 percent cap apply to every blister card in retail?
No. The 50 percent cap applies specifically to grouped packaging, transport packaging, and e-commerce packaging that fall within the regulation's scope. A standard retail blister card is certainly still relevant under minimization rules, but the compliance review focuses entirely on its necessary weight and volume rather than a generalized 50 percent cap.
Can filler materials solve the void ratio by themselves?
No. While filler materials can certainly help protect products, they should not be treated as an automatic answer to PPWR empty space questions. The official measurement method and the resulting legal interpretations still matter greatly, meaning teams should avoid making quick assumptions too early in the process.
Does a smaller retail pack always mean less selling power?
No. A smaller package can still perform exceptionally well when the printed graphics are crisp, the product remains highly visible, and the overall structure supports a premium shelf presentation. In many cases, strong, deliberate design choices create far better shelf presence than simply adding extra, unused volume.
Can multi-panel or free-standing formats avoid minimization rules?
No. These specialized formats can be incredibly useful for expansive communication or distinct displays, but they still require a legitimate functional reason to justify their material usage and total volume. They remain specialized design options, meaning they must be rigorously reviewed just like any other packaging format.
